PulseView 는 Qt 기반 오픈소스 로직분석기 및 오실로스코프 GUI 프로그램이다. 로직분석기를 연결하여 UART, I²C, CAN 등의 다양한 디지털 신호를 측정할 수 있다.
로직분석기를 CAN_RX 라인에 연결하여 신호를 캡쳐해본다.
PulseView 의 CAN 디코더는 단일 CAN_RX 라인이 샘플링된다고 가정한다. 예를 들어 Microchip MCP-2515DM-BM과 같은 CAN 트랜시버 IC의 디지털 출력 측에 해당한다.
필자는 SN65HVD230 트랜시버의 RX 출력 측에 로직 분석기 CH1 을 연결하고 PulseView 에서 D0 를 다음과 같이 설정하였다.

임의로 생성한 CAN 프레임

CAN 프레임이 캡쳐된 모습

| 번호 | 제목 | 글쓴이 | 날짜 | 조회 수 |
|---|---|---|---|---|
| 14 |
POSIX를 지원하는 오픈소스 RTOS, RTEMS
| makersweb | 2020.04.15 | 5195 |
| 13 |
라즈베리파이2에서 RTOS기반 GPIO제어(LED)
| makersweb | 2020.04.21 | 5159 |
| 12 | Raspberry Pi 의 프레임버퍼(Framebuffer)구성 | makersweb | 2020.05.15 | 6159 |
| 11 |
Android 기기를 사용하여 Raspberry Pi SD 카드 작성 방법
| makersweb | 2020.08.01 | 4760 |
| 10 | 플랫폼 디바이스 및 디바이스 트리 | makersweb | 2021.03.20 | 6398 |
| 9 |
ATtiny85 개발보드(HW-260)
| makersweb | 2023.01.02 | 4045 |
| 8 |
임베디드 개발자를 위한 Hex,Bin,Dec 변환기 유틸
| makersweb | 2023.02.27 | 6147 |
| » |
로직분석기와 함께 PulseView 를 사용해서 CAN 신호 캡쳐
| makersweb | 2023.03.16 | 3829 |
| 6 |
Raspberry Pi 와 ATtiny85 간 I²C 통신
| makersweb | 2023.03.18 | 4167 |
| 5 | Yocto 프로젝트 3.4 릴리스(honister) 이상 버전으로 마이그레이션 시 참고 사항 | makersweb | 2023.03.21 | 4448 |
| 4 | Raspberry Pi에서 I²C 그리고 Bit-bang (비트뱅) | makersweb | 2023.08.27 | 4229 |
| 3 | Rockchip VOP | makersweb | 2024.04.22 | 3394 |
| 2 |
OpenAMP 간단한 소개
| makersweb | 2024.09.21 | 3364 |
| 1 |
임베디드 리눅스 시스템에서 Flutter와 Wayland의 조합
| makersweb | 2025.08.21 | 3125 |